Presently, 14% Sahiwalcows have their best lactation 305 day milk yields of 3000kg and above.••Highest yielding buffalo namely Karankeerti has produceda peak yield of 23.3 kg in a day and produced 4428 kgof milk in a lactation period of 427 days during her firstlactation. This record holder buffalo is the daughter ofMurrah bull no. 4915, which has been declared proven bullunder Set VII.••The performance recording including information on daily,weekly and monthly test day milk yields and part lactationFig. Observed and predicted WTDMYs (kg) for inverse polynomialfunction in Sahiwal cattlerecords of the daughters of Sahiwal, KF and Murrahbulls was done. The test day lactation curve models weredeveloped using daily, weekly and monthly test day milkyields and part lactation records for predicting monthly andtotal lactation milk yields in organized herds and underfield conditions.••Two sets each of Sahiwal (11 bulls) and KF (17 bulls) andthree sets of Murrah bulls (43 bulls) were evaluated duringthe period. Out of these bulls, 4 Sahiwal, 5 KF and 3Murrah bulls were selected as proven bulls with their EBVsranging from 1641-1917 kg, 3228-4144 kg and 1972-2116kg, respectively; while their superiority over herd averageranged from 9.33-27.73%, 12.00-16.70% and 8.41-17.26%,respectively.••During 2007-2011, a total of 2152 KF and 2325 Murrahfemale progeny were born from bulls under field conditions.••The growth bands were constructed for male and femalecalves using 26 weeks body weight in Sahiwal calves.Average daily weight gain from birth to twenty six weeks (6months) of age was 339 g/day in female calves and 333.5 g/day in male calves.••The different methods of sire evaluation namelycontemporary comparison, least squares, simple regressedleast squares, BLUP and DFREML were used to evaluatesires. The single trait DFREML was more efficient thanmulti trait DFREML for estimating the breeding value ofSahiwal sires for FL305DMY, individual third month milkyield and cumulative 90 days milk yield.••For prediction of first lactation 305-day milk yield inSahiwal cattle, Multiple Linear Regression (MLR) andArtificial Neural Network (ANN) models were developedusing body weights at different ages as independentvariables and FL305DMY as dependent variable andthe accuracy of fitting both models was compared.
